The European Performance Engineering Workshop is
an annual event that aims to gather researchers working on all aspects
of performance modelling and analysis.
We solicit original papers on performance
evaluation
techniques for
computer and
telecommunication systems analysis as well as for the
analysis of manufacturing systems,
real-time and embedded systems.
Papers on or related to the following topics
are particularly welcome.

Authors are invited to submit papers to the
workshop by June 8, 2007. The submission is now closed.
Submissions must be original and should not have been published
previously or be under consideration for publication while being
evaluated for this workshop.
The proceedings will be published as a volume in the SpringerVerlag
Lecture Notes in Computer Science (LNCS) series, as have been the
proceedings of the previous Performance Engineering Workshops. In their
final version, papers are to be
prepared in LNCS format and must not exceed 15 pages, including
figures, tables and references. The first page should contain title,
authors names and affiliation, and a list of keywords. The papers must
be electronically submitted in PDF or PS format through the conference
management system EasyChair.
